The incumbent serves as an engineering research psychologist in the Air Traffic Systems Test & Evaluation Services, Human-Systems Integration Branch at the FAA William J. Hughes Technical Center. The incumbent works in the Research Development and Human Factors Laboratory and conducts human factors research, engineering, development, testing, and evaluations. The incumbent’s work supports the FAA mission to provide the safest and most efficient aerospace system in the world by improving the performance and effectiveness of the human operators of aviation systems. These operators include air traffic controllers, air traffic managers, technical
operations specialists, pilots, unmanned aircraft operators, dispatchers, aviation safety inspectors, and maintenance technicians.

The incumbent applies detailed technical knowledge of psychological principles, practices, and techniques to solve complex human factors problems in the aviation domain. Typical assignments include: planning, preparing, and executing human-in-the-loop simulations; collecting, reducing, analyzing, and visualizing human factors data; conducting interviews, field observations, and focus groups with subject-matter experts; and conducting iterative rapid prototyping of user interfaces and conducting usability tests.
• Conducts reviews of relevant scholarly and technical literature across multiple domains, including psychology, engineering, computer science, and graphic design.
• Serves as a contributing author or co-author to research plans that outline the objectives, hypotheses, methods, metrics, and resources for projects.
• Collects human factors data following established techniques and tools, including surveys and questionnaires, video and audio recordings, and physiological monitoring devices.
• Conducts data analyses using established techniques and tools, including inferential statistics, data mining, and fast-time modeling.
• Serves as contributing author or co-author for FAA technical reports and journal articles; presents briefings and papers at professional conferences.
• Contributes relevant human factors information to requirements documents, system specifications, test procedures, standards, and guidelines.
• Conducts all activities in compliance with ethical standards for the protection of human subjects.
